Farmers Markets: Your Figgy Paradise

Let's start with the obvious: farmers markets. LA is practically drowning in them, and most of them have a fig or two (or a whole bunch) to offer. The Original Farmers Market on Fairfax is a classic, but there are countless others scattered throughout the city.

Grocery Stores: Figgy Finds

Your local grocery store is probably your safest bet for consistent fig availability. Places like Whole Foods, Erewhon, and even your regular ol' supermarket will likely have figs, especially during fig season. Just keep in mind that grocery store figs might not be as fresh or flavorful as those from a farmers market.

Figgy Tips and Tricks

  • Timing is everything: Figs are typically in season from late summer to early fall, but you can find them year-round with a little effort.
  • Don't be afraid to ask: If you don't see figs at your favorite market, ask a vendor if they can special order them for you.
  • Experiment with different varieties: There are countless varieties of figs out there, each with its own unique flavor and texture.

How to... Figgy FAQs

How to choose the perfect fig: Look for figs that are soft and plump, with slightly open tops. Avoid figs that are hard, dry, or moldy.How to store figs: Store figs at room temperature for a day or two, or in the refrigerator for up to a week.How to ripen figs: If your figs are not quite ripe, place them in a paper bag with a banana for a day or two.How to eat figs: Figs can be eaten fresh, dried, or cooked. They are delicious on their own, or paired with other fruits, cheeses, or meats.How to grow your own figs: Figs are relatively easy to grow in warm climates. You can start your own fig tree from a cutting or a seedling.
